Output ec61c0f15019d662a95ad90609cd8b26f08567771eb9a7075fe9a642fbc8aee3:1

value
1049800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62825cef31dc3b30d5f4703054d616cc39ea50a6 OP_EQUAL
address
MGt2d1cMmQ5J1DVmubct33JWYm8jsPySnM
transaction
ec61c0f15019d662a95ad90609cd8b26f08567771eb9a7075fe9a642fbc8aee3
spent
true